Output 7452917aef13c66c8549a8e518b0f7632a1814fef6ffcc3e1d64e818614a95c6:0

value
32304
script pubkey
OP_0 OP_PUSHBYTES_20 baa5cbf0c3c77713f6fcb9d61ba7e04f850bf24f
address
tb1qh2juhuxrcam38ahuh8tphflqf7zshuj0sa4k0w
transaction
7452917aef13c66c8549a8e518b0f7632a1814fef6ffcc3e1d64e818614a95c6